數: 120050642
國家: India
源: Central public Procurement portal India
數: 119828860
源: RFQ
數: 119651248
數: 119277316
數: 119100300
數: 119078975
數: 119079719
數: 119082434
數: 118999479
數: 118973141
數: 118979484
數: 118552477
數: 118330809
數: 118180424
數: 117950233
數: 117933339
數: 117835642
數: 117752870
數: 117752933
數: 117600092